Flood Damage Restoration Services

Flood damage restoration involves the process of assessing, cleaning, and repairing properties affected by water intrusion caused by flooding events. This service typically includes water extraction, drying, dehumidification, and the removal of damaged building materials. The goal is to restore the property to its pre-flood condition, minimizing further damage and preventing issues such as mold growth or structural deterioration. Professional restoration providers use specialized equipment and techniques to ensure thorough cleanup and mitigation of water-related problems.

Flooding can lead to significant issues for property owners, including structural damage, mold development, and compromised indoor air quality. Water intrusion often results in damaged flooring, walls, and insulation, which can weaken the integrity of a building. Additionally, standing water and residual moisture create ideal conditions for mold and bacteria growth, posing health risks to occupants. Flood damage restoration services help address these problems by removing excess water, drying affected areas, and disinfecting surfaces to promote a safe and healthy environment.

The overview below groups typical Flood Damage Restoration proj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Spokane County, WA.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Initial Cleanup Costs - The cost for water extraction and debris removal typically ranges from $1,000 to $3,500, depending on the severity of flooding and property size. This includes removing standing water and cleaning affected areas.

Structural Restoration Expenses - Restoring damaged walls, flooring, and ceilings can cost between $5,000 and $20,000. The total depends on the extent of structural damage and materials needed.

Mold Remediation Costs - Addressing mold growth resulting from flood damage usually falls within $2,000 to $8,000. Larger areas or extensive mold issues may increase this estimate.

Additional Repair Services - Services such as electrical or HVAC system repairs after flooding can add $1,500 to $10,000 to the overall cost. These costs vary based on the complexity of the repairs needed.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
